What to check before for buildings with low open violation rates in Wakefield

  • Look for buildings with comprehensive maintenance records to ensure a safe living environment.
  • Verify the building's complaint history and confirm that violations have been addressed before signing a lease.
  • Ask current residents about their experiences and any unresolved issues with the building.
  • Understand that low violation numbers do not guarantee a perfect living situation; engaging with the community is key.
  • Check for any additional fees related to maintenance or building amenities that could affect your budget.
